The Rockhurst men begin a four-game homestand at Mason-Halpin Field House, with the first three taking place this week. Rockhurst will face McKendree on Monday at 7:30 p.m., William Jewell on Thursday at 7:30 p..m as part of the KC Crown rivalry and will finish the week against Kansas Christian on Saturday at 3 p.m.
The Hawks (4-2, 1-0 GLVC) had one game last week, a 90-77 victory over Truman State last Tuesday evening in Kirksville, Missouri. For the second straight game, four Hawks scored in double figures, including two who scored 20 points or more.
Jesse White led the Hawks with 27 points (an NCAA career-high). Brian Hawthorne finished with 20 points, eight assists and seven rebounds.
Daniel Carr scored 18 points and recorded nine rebounds, while Nick Arensberg tallied 14 points.
McKendree (4-3, 1-0 GLVC) defeated Maryville, 74-66, last Saturday. The Bearcats come into Monday's contest averaging 71.3 points per game with 46.2 percent shooting from the field.
Dating back to 2014, McKendree leads the all-time series, 7-6, and are on a six-game winning streak against Rockhurst. Most recently, the Hawks fell 85-81 to the Bearcats on Nov. 30, 2023, in Lebanon, Illinois.
William Jewell (3-3, 0-0 GLVC) fell 78-77 to Missouri Western last Tuesday. The Cardinals will face Illinois Springfield on Monday to begin conference play before facing Rockhurst on Thursday.
Rockhurst holds a 90-68 lead in the all-time series. Jewell is on a seven-game winning streak against Rockhurst. On Feb. 17, 2024, the Hawks fell 82-50 to William Jewell in their most recent contest.
Kansas Christian (2-4) defeated Hesston College, 85-70, last Saturday. The Falcons will face Barclay on Tuesday before their matchup against the Hawks on Saturday.
Saturday's upcoming contest between the Hawks and Falcons will be just the second time the two teams have faced each other. The only game between Rockhurst and Kansas Christian took place on Jan. 8, 2019, when the Hawks won 115-76 at Mason-Halpin Field House.
